For homeowners in Kansas, particularly within the Wichita and Olathe metropolitan areas, the demands on window installation services are shaped by a climate characterized by extreme temperature fluctuations and significant meteorological events. This includes intensely hot summers, frigid winters, and the potential for severe storms, necessitating window systems that offer robust thermal performance, durability, and resilience against harsh weather conditions.

Kansas's housing stock varies, from historic farmhouses to contemporary suburban dwellings, each presenting specific installation challenges. Our methodology emphasizes a thorough evaluation of existing fenestration, focusing on the structural integrity of frames and the effectiveness of the current weatherproofing, especially in areas prone to high winds and hail. Adherence to Kansas's building codes and energy efficiency standards is paramount, often leading to the specification of double or triple-pane windows equipped with low-emissivity (Low-E) coatings and argon gas fills to mitigate both significant heat gain and loss. The distinct seasons dictate our installation approach: summer installations prioritize immediate heat rejection and UV protection, while winter installations require meticulous sealing to prevent thermal bridging and air infiltration, ensuring year-round comfort and optimized energy consumption.

What are the main cost factors for window installation in Kansas?

The cost of window installation in Kansas is primarily determined by the complexity of removing existing windows, the performance specifications of the replacement units chosen (e.g., U-factor, SHGC), and the condition of the existing wall structure. For Wichita and Olathe installations, factors like the potential need for impact-resistant glazing due to severe weather and the precise application of specialized sealants for extreme temperature variations are critical considerations.

Are permits necessary for window replacements in Kansas?

Permit requirements for window replacements in Kansas can differ based on local city or county ordinances and the scope of the project. While simple, like-for-like replacements might not always require a permit, any structural modifications or alterations to the window opening typically necessitate approval. We ensure all installations in the Wichita and Olathe metro areas comply with relevant building codes.

Is it more cost-effective to replace all windows in my Kansas home at once?

Undertaking a comprehensive window replacement for your Kansas residence can often yield greater long-term economic benefits. This consolidated approach typically allows for better bulk pricing on materials and optimizes labor scheduling, potentially reducing the per-unit installation cost. Furthermore, it guarantees consistent energy performance across your entire property, maximizing utility savings.
